Leadership - Frank Sulzer, CPP
Frank Sulzer, CPP is an Adjunct Instructor and Senior Faculty Member for Enterprising Securities, based in San Antonio , TX . Since 2006 , Mr. Sulzer's responsibilities have included: business development and implementation of advanced level educational programs, expert witness and security consultation.
With more than 20 years of experience in the corporate security industry, Mr. Sulzer graduated Cum Laude from California State University . A second generation security professional, Mr. Sulzer was raised in the risk management industry and held his first security position at age 18. He has been responsible for a wide spectrum of security functions including: guard force management, risk and vulnerability assessments, business continuity planning and sensitive investigations for high ranking electronics manufacturers, petrol chemical companies, medical facilities and aviation entities. Mr. Sulzer works with federal, state and local agencies to mitigate clients' risks and provide sound asset protection programs.
Working with both the public and private sectors, Mr. Sulzer has designed and executed learning and development programs to facilitate client specific needs and training requirements. His training accomplishments include: CPP Review Program, Protection of Assets, Workplace Violence, Sexual Harassment, Disaster Management and Incident Control. He has been sought out as a speaker for local, regional and national events and has provided training on the individual and group level.
Mr. Sulzer is an officer in Sulzer Enterprises, established in 1980 specializing in litigation consulting for premise liability cases involving all aspects of physical security. In addition, Sulzer Enterprises conducts sensitive investigations along with security vulnerability and risk assessments.
Mr. Sulzer is a Certified Protection Professional (CPP) and an active member and chapter chairman of the American Society for Industrial Security (ASIS) International. He is also an associate member of Certified Fraud Examiners, member of International Association for Healthcare Safety and Security, member of the American College of Forensic Examiners International and member of the National Classification Management Society, Inc.
